MIKE REILLY
Marion
Mike Reilly, 76, of Marion, died Wednesday, April 29, 2015, at his home. A Celebration of Life will be at 1:30 p.m. Friday, May 8, at Murdoch Funeral Home & Cremation Service, Marion. The family will greet friends one hour before the celebration of life at the funeral home in Marion. To honor Mike, the family requests casual dress.
Survivors include his brothers, Gary (Sandra) Reilly of Rogers, Ark., and Larry (Necie Lenel) Reilly of Fort Worth, Texas; sister, Stacy (Jeffrey) Castillo of Fort Worth, Texas; best friend and companion, Donna Reilly of Marion, and her children, Tina Renee (Kirk) Cunningham of Hinsdale, Ill., Shane Reilly (Alisse Diers) of Marion and Josh Reilly (May Vitug) of Richmond, Calif; grandchildren, Reilly, Coleman and Kirby Cunningham and Reagan Reilly; and many n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.
He was preceded in death by his mother and father.
Mike was born March 13, 1939, in Fort Worth, Texas, the son of Thomas Joseph and Agnes Glyn (Waite) Reilly. He graduated from University of Texas– Arlington, with a degree in geology.
Mike was an avid woodworker and skilled craftsman, most recently working on his retirement cabin in East Texas. He enjoyed fishing, cooking, gardening and rock collecting. He loved to read, and had a continued interest in learning. Family was very important.
Mike will be greatly missed.
